Latest Patents

Ze-wen Zhang holds a patent for a "Mechanism for transmitting elementary streams in a broadcast environment." This patent describes techniques and mechanisms aimed at transmitting elementary streams effectively. The mechanisms include a buffer controller and packet scheduler that facilitate the transmission of media formats with low channel switch delays. A buffer-fullness indicator is utilized to ensure compatibility with various types of decoders. The invention calculates lower and upper bounds for each frame within the elementary stream, determining optimal send times to prevent overflow and underflow conditions in decoder buffers.
